Sources indicate a divided opinion within WWE concerning the future of The Vision. One perspective suggests the faction could continue but would require a significant reimagining with new roster members to revitalize it. Conversely, another viewpoint holds that the faction has run its course and that its members should move on to new opportunities.
The recent events, including Bronson Reed and Logan Paul being sidelined with injuries, Bron Breakker appearing at a career crossroads, and Austin Theory reportedly facing humiliation on Raw, seem to align with the idea that WWE might be considering disbanding The Vision.
The unusual conclusion to Breakker's steel cage match at Night of Champions, where he appeared to beg off before attempting a comeback only to be defeated by Rollins has led many fans to speculate about a potential character shift for Breakker, possibly leading to a babyface turn. However, reports suggest that despite any outcomes with The Vision, Paul Heyman is expected to remain aligned with Breakker. The company reportedly views Heyman as integral to Breakker's presentation on WWE programming.
In related news, Paul Heyman has also been involved with Brock Lesnar as Lesnar prepares for a rubber match against Oba Femi inside Hell in a Cell at SummerSlam.
